i want a cb breeding pair of every breed that can have one, and pink sapphs have been a real problem for me. i kept releasing sapphs onto the ap and being unable to click them (turns out you cant reclaim your own abandoned eggs for some reason), so now i just refresh looking for someone else's sapph to steal. none on the trading hub currently either. is the best way to get a pink sapph just to get lucky when viewing the ap or is there an easier way? and if i were to trade for one, what would they be worth?

Share this post


Link to post

You have to haunt the AP or trade. (Trade was how I got mine....) Yes indeed - you cannot reclaim your own eggs until someone else picks them up first - and with pink sapphires that isn't going to happen. Trading - open the trading page, select sapphires and see what people are asking. I have traded for - a pair of 2 gen golds; and a 3 gen even prize together with a CB blue sapphire - just see what people ask when there's one up there. There is no easy way - sorry.
